If R, S, and T are collinear and RS + ST = RT, which of the following is true? A. T is between R and S.B. RS=RT
C. S is the midpoint of.
D. S is between R and T.

Answers

The answer is D. S is between R and T.

Imagine a line, which a starting point is R and a final point is T. And somewhere in between a point S. 
The total distance is RT (from the starting to the final point).
The distance RS is one part of the line, and the distance ST is the other part of the line. If these two distances sum up, you will get the total distance:
RS + ST = RT

Convert each measure to radians and state answer in terms of pi. a.) 40(degrees) b.) -570(degrees)

Answers

360 degrees=2pi radians

therefor set up a ratio and proportiopn

a.
360/2pi=40/x
times 2pix both sides
360x=80pi
divide both sides by 360
x=(2pi)/9 radians


b.
360/2pi=-570/x
times 2pix both sides
360x=-1140pi
divide boh sides by 360
x=-(19pi)/6 radians
